Method
Instructions
- 1
Prepare the Dough
In a large b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let it sit for about 5 minutes until frothy. Then, add olive oil, salt, and flour gradually, mixing until a dough forms.
- 2
Knead the Dough
Transfer the dough to a floured surface and knead for about 5-7 minutes until smooth and elastic.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over with a cloth,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.
- 3
Shape the Knots
Once the dough has risen, punch it down and divide it into equal pieces (about 12-16). Roll each piece into a rope and tie it into a knot. Place the knots on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- 4
Prepare the Garlic Butter
In a small saucepan, melt the unsalted butter over low heat. Add minced garlic and c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ant. Remove from heat and stir in chopped parsley and grated Parmesan cheese.
